Thanks to those sticking up for Northeast Ohio! :D I can only speak for the 12u age, but I think we have some fantastic talent up here :yahoo:

Granted, they may not be out of the Lake County area, and we are somewhat spread out, but there are many great teams at the 12u level in NE Ohio. For example, in last week's vote, 10 out of the top 15 teams are from NE Ohio area: Ice Orange, Diamond Chix, Thunder Elite '00, Ice White, Ohio Power, NOS [Hurricanes], Emeralds '99, Wolfpack, Thunder Elite '99, and Ohio Blast. Even when you look at the overall voting for the season, we still have 9 out of the top 15 teams.

Yes, we have to do some traveling to get to most of the BIG tournaments (Lasers, GAPPS, etc), but that doesn't mean that NE Ohio doesn't have a lot of talented fastpitch players and teams!

It's not that there aren't any good softball players in NEO. The problem is there are too many teams with incompetant fathers running the show. There are only a few organizations that continually focus on players develpoment and challenging thier players to play at the highest level. Every organization in NEO has one team that is really good and as soon as that team runs its course the coaces / dads move on too. There are some good ones out there and once you find one, you will know.
